On the 29th, Disney+ released a poster and video of Garden Go NEW Heroes in 'Moving'. 'Moving' is the story of children who live in the present while hiding their superpowers and parents who live in the past while hiding painful secrets.

Here, the copy "You're not weird. You're just special" is added, foreshadowing a story in which three children who have not yet fully mastered their superpowers will gradually realize their true abilities and grow.

'Moving' will be released on Disney+ on August 9th, with 7 episodes released simultaneously worldwide, followed by 2 episodes per week.
